[LV] Consider Loop Unroll Hints When Making Interleave Decisions
This patch causes the loop vectorizer to not interleave loops that have nounroll loop hints (llvm.loop.unroll.disable and llvm.loop.unroll_count(1)). Note that if a particular interleave count is being requested (through llvm.loop.interleave_count), it will still be honoured, regardless of the presence of nounroll hints.

[LV][VPlan] Detect outer loops for explicit vectorization.
Patch #2 from VPlan Outer Loop Vectorization Patch Series #1 (RFC: http://lists.llvm.org/pipermail/llvm-dev/2017-December/119523.html).
This patch introduces the basic infrastructure to detect, legality check and process outer loops annotated with hints for explicit vectorization. All these changes are protected under the feature flag -enable-vplan-native-path. This should make this patch NFC for the existing inner loop vectorizer.
